Xi Jinping's Military Purge Raises Taiwan Readiness Concerns

Story summary
- Chinese President Xi Jinping has intensified a military purge, removing more than 100 officers since 2022, including top generals.
- A Center for Strategic and International Studies report notes that 36 generals and lieutenant generals have been purged, raising concerns about the People's Liberation Army's readiness for complex operations.
- The loss of experienced commanders could hinder large campaigns, particularly regarding Taiwan.
